Sibbjäns, Sweden
In May 2026, Sibbjäns, the first boutique farm stay in Sweden, launched on Gotland, an island known for its beautiful landscapes. This luxury establishment features 22 uniquely designed rooms, a natural swimming pool, and wellness amenities including a Nordic sauna and outdoor gym. Central to its ethos is a working farm housing hens, Mangalitza pigs, horses, and sheep. The culinary program emphasizes seasonal produce cultivated on the premises, embodying a farm-to-fork philosophy that connects gastronomy directly to agriculture.
At Sibbjäns, guests participate in activities such as harvesting fresh ingredients and understanding how farming shapes kitchen operations. Such hands-on experiences not only enhance the dining options but also deepen the understanding of how local flavors are crafted, making the surrounding landscape an integral part of the menu. Borgo Antichi Orti Assisi, Italy
Nestled in the picturesque hills of Assisi, Borgo Antichi Orti Assisi places a significant focus on truffles. Under the guidance of Chef Ilaria Maurizi, guests can engage in guided truffle foraging expeditions, accompanied by trained truffle dogs, throughout the region’s lush landscape. After the foraging journey, participants return to the hotel’s acclaimed restaurant, ReTartu, where seasonal truffles are featured prominently in dishes crafted with homemade pasta and locally sourced meats, further complemented by vegetables harvested from the hotel’s gardens.
This immersive approach not only celebrates Italy’s rich culinary heritage but also allows guests to appreciate the intricate relationships between local foods, such as truffles, and the land they come from. The gastronomic experiences at Borgo Antichi Orti Assisi emphasize the thrilling journey from forest to table, enriching the overall travel experience in the heart of Italy. Mandapa, a Ritz-Carlton Reserve, Bali
Mandapa, a Ritz-Carlton Reserve located in the lush rainforest near Ubud, Bali, offers unique opportunities for guests to connect with the island’s rich biodiversity. Led by Chef Eka, the property offers hands-on foraging experiences where guests can explore rice paddies, gardens, and surrounding forests. Participants learn to identify wild herbs, edible flowers, and medicinal plants that form the backbone of traditional Balinese cuisine.
The ingredients gathered during these excursions are later utilized in dishes served that evening, thus creating a dining experience that is both fresh and deeply integrated into local culinary practices. This immersive approach at Mandapa not only emphasizes sustainability but also ensures that guests gain a profound understanding of how the local landscape influences culinary traditions.
